Six Knights Moving On to the Next Level

The Knights have had a lot of success on the court during Head Coach Mitch Charlens' tenure, but his players have also triumphed in the classroom. Each year, Charlens' teams have had multiple players move on to 4-year universities and 2023 was no exception with six Knights transferring.

Knights Advance to Sweet Sixteen Behind Stifling Defense!

The No. 8 Knights have advanced to the sweet sixteen for the third consecutive season after getting past No. 24 Copper Mountain, 66-56, in a second round playoff with Lorenzo Wright leading the way offensively with 18 points off the bench. The No. 8 seed Knights will travel to play at No. 1 Fullerton on Saturday, March 4 at 7 p.m. in a Southern California regional final with the winner heading to the state championship quarterfinals.

Freshman Al Green Shines With 33 Points in Win Over Palomar

Playing in front of the largest home crowd of the season on sophomore night, it was freshman Al Green who carried the Knights offensively with a career-high 33 points on 10-of-13 shooting in a 91-86 home win over Palomar. It was the Knights' seventh win in the last eight games as improved to 22-5 overall and 13-2 in the PCAC.

No. 8 Knights Stay Undefeated in PCAC With Win Over No. 14 Miramar

Both No. 8 San Diego City and No. 14 Miramar both came into Monday's MLK matchup at Harry West Gym undefeated in the PCAC, but it was the Knights who prevailed, 82-60, with Lorenzo Wright and Al Green leading the team offensively with 22 and 21 points, respectively, as the Knights improved to 15-3 overall and 6-0 in the conference.

Knights Open Season With Back-to-Back Wins

San Diego City, ranked No. 6 in Southern California, opened the 2022-23 campaign this weekend at Santa Monica's O'Fallon and Singui Classic and came away with a 95-56 blowout win over Compton and an 81-70 victory over Santa Monica to start the season at 2-0. The Knights had five players score in double figures in the win over Compton and had four players with at least 11 points in the road win over Santa Monica, including Lorenzo Wright who scored 31 total points in the two games.
